Wholesale exporting is undergoing significant changes as businesses adapt to new market realities. This article highlights key trends shaping the future of this industry.
Digital transformation is at the forefront of change in wholesale exporting. Companies must embrace technology to stay competitive.
Adopting e-commerce solutions can help businesses reach global markets more efficiently and improve customer engagement.
As sustainability becomes a priority for consumers, wholesale exporters must adapt by integrating eco-friendly practices into their operations.
Building green supply chains not only meets consumer demands but also enhances brand reputation and loyalty.
Utilizing data analytics can provide insights into market trends and customer preferences, allowing businesses to make informed decisions.
Investing in market analytics tools can help businesses understand customer behaviors and improve product offerings accordingly.
To mitigate risks, businesses are diversifying their supplier relationships and sourcing locations.
Implementing multiple sourcing strategies can enhance resilience and flexibility in supply chain operations.
Providing exceptional customer service is increasingly important in wholesale exporting, with businesses focusing on building long-term relationships.
Utilizing feedback loops and personalized communication can greatly enhance the customer experience.
By recognizing and adapting to these key trends, wholesale exporters can position themselves for success in an evolving global market.
